N. Jakarta Mayor Supports Improvement of Worker Welfare

As many as 2,850 workers packed the Rawa Badak Stadium, Rawa Badak Selatan Urban Village, Koja, North Jakarta to commemorate May Day.

North Jakarta Mayor, Ali Maulana Hakim strongly supports efforts to improve the welfare of workers.

"This is of course the duty, function and role of the government to improve the welfare of its people. We always try to have no worries in trying and working thus to create prosperity in terms of the community's economy," he expressed, Wednesday (5/1).

He gave appreciation for the presence of thousands of workers at the May Day commemoration organized by the North Jakarta administration together with the local Tripartite Cooperation Institute (LKS) and related stakeholders.

"This is also a gathering place for workers to get to know each other. Let's celebrate this togetherness happily," he explained.

He added the North Jakarta Tripartite LKS was ready to accommodate all workers' aspirations to be discussed and realized according to its capacity.

"It aims to ensure that no worry for anyone who runs a business and works, thereby creating economic prosperity," he added.

North Jakarta May Day Committee Chairman, Bambang Haryanto uttered those attending today came from some federations and trade unions in North Jakarta.

"This year's May Day is packed with various events such as musical entertainment, donations, distribution of BPJS cards, cheap food bazaars, blood donations, health checks, and door prize distribution," he explained.

He added this packaged workers' ideals that fit into the sub-theme of the event, namely, "Prosperous Workers, Advanced Entrepreneurs, Successful North Jakarta".

"We all agree that the investment value in North Jakarta must be better and more conducive. So, we invite our colleagues to hold a useful activity like this," he added.

He plans that May Day next year will be packaged as Family Labor because family such as children and wives are part of the support or encouragement in working.

"God willing, next year, we will hold it again by inviting the families of workers and laborers to make it even more festive and united," he added.

The May Day action received appreciation from one of the workers, Usman (46).

"Very happy and entertained, hopefully next year we can do it again. Hopefully, the workers' welfare in North Jakarta can continue to improve," he closed.
